KL Rahul donates shoes to COVID-19 warriors; lauds their tireless efforts

Doctors and healthcare workers are on the forefront to battle the Coronavirus pandemic.

KL Rahul | AFPIndia batsman KL Rahul has thanked his country’s doctors and healthcare workers who are on the forefront to battle the Coronavirus pandemic, which has claimed more than 366,000 lives and infected over 6,000,000 people globally.

In India, around 1,73,000 confirmed cases have been reported thus far while 4970 people have lost their lives despite the strict nationwide lockdown since March.

Amid the crisis, frontline warriors have been tirelessly working round the clock by risking their lives and their families.

On Friday (May 29), Rahul expressed his gratitude by donating PUMA shoes to doctors and healthcare workers across the state capital.

The stylish right-hander also shared a heartfelt note for them on Twitter which reads: "Thank you for risking it all to take care of our country. This is a small token of my gratitude and respect to let you know you are appreciated. Keep fighting the good fight. Thank you."

Talking about his gesture, Rahul said: "I wanted to do something for those that are putting themselves at risk for all of us in this fight. So I reached out to PUMA to see how we can help out. It's important at this time that everyone tries to do their bit. This fight is a collective one."

"A word of encouragement during struggle is worth more than an hour of praise after success. We will succeed and it will be because of this encouragement that keeps us going. Thank you K.L.Rahul and PUMA for keeping us motivated at this time of crisis!" said COVID warriors Bowring and Lady Curzon Hospitals, Shivajinagar.

Last month, KL Rahul had auctioned his 2019 World Cup bat and other precious memorabilia to help the underprivileged children during the ongoing epidemic.
